Unlock with a known password

Enter a valid password for the PDF and create a new copy without password encryption.

No password bypass

The tool is designed for files you are authorized to access and requires the PDF password.

Browser-side decryption

QPDF processes the selected file in the browser and creates a separate unlocked PDF.

Tips for better results

For PDF files, start with the cleanest source you have. Password protection, damaged files, unusual embedded fonts, very large scans, or image-only pages can affect what any browser-based PDF workflow can read or change. If the document is a scan and you need selectable text, an OCR step may be more appropriate before editing or converting.

Before downloading or sharing the finished file, give the result a quick review. Check the pages, text, images, order, formatting, or file size that matter for your task. If the output is not what you expected, go back to the source file and make sure it is the right version and format before trying again.

Unlock PDF FAQs

Quick answers to common questions about this workflow.

Can I remove a PDF password?

Yes, when you know a valid password for the PDF. Choose the file, enter the password, and create the unlocked copy.

Can this crack an unknown PDF password?

No. This tool requires a valid password and is not a password-cracking service.

Does unlocking modify my original file?

No. It creates a new PDF without password encryption.
